Command

/Banall <PlayerName|IP Address> [Reason]

Bans a players name, IP, and all other accounts associated with the IP. If player is not online, last known IP associated with the name is used. You can also type in the IP address directly. Any text after the player name will be saved as the [reason]. Ban information can be viewed with /baninfo
